Steven H. Williams, MD answers: Do butt lifts look real?

I'm considering a butt lift and would like to know if it feels and more importantly looks real?

Thanks for the question Eddie -

I would strongly encourage you to speak to a board certified plastic surgeon who performs autologous fat transfer buttock lifts (the Brazilian Butt Lift).

In my practice, we have had wonderful results with this surgery. The benefit of using your own fat is you avoid the risks of implants (inferior feel, implant shifting, infection, scar tissue). In addition you get liposuction of other typically problematic areas.

The technique does require some skill so be sure and speak with someone who has experience with the technique.
